- [ ] Idempotency keys for payment retries (Tollgate service). Confirm every retry path — client timeout, gateway 5xx, webhook replay — reuses the original key rather than minting a new one. Keys persist 72h in the Brindle store; verify TTL config matches staging. Duplicate-charge canary must run green for 24h before signoff. Mira owns rollback. Double-submit tests live in the settlement suite and must pass on the candidate build, which is recorded below for the audit trail.

trace token, bajof-fahif: htk21_7f5ed969de03e4870a26f

Handover — Vexler partner SFTP drop

Ownership moves to you today. Drop runs hourly from Vexler's end into the intake bucket via the relay host. Watch for zero-byte files; their exporter flakes on Mondays. Creds live in the ops vault, path noted in the runbook. Vault auto-seals after 48h idle. Support escalations go to the on-call rotation, not me. If the vault is sealed when you need it, unseal with the recovery passphrase below.

recovery phrase for tadug-fafof: zorwyn-kasion

## Account Recovery — Trailnote Offline Mode

When a surveyor's Trailnote app has been offline for 30+ days, their local credentials expire and sync refuses to resume. Don't make them wipe the device — all their unsynced field data lives there! Instead, open the support console, pick "Offline Reinstate," and enter their handle. The console will ask for the support team's shared recovery passphrase before issuing a reinstatement token. Use the one below.

unlock words, bagaf-fajeg: zorael-kelax-fraath-quenix-eliok-sileth-aldmir-wenir-druiel